Mazda Familia BH, 8 generation 06.1994 - 09.1996

8 generation
(BH) 06.1994 - 09.1996

The eighth generation Familia, which was produced in sedan and three-door hatchback bodies, became the owner of a very convenient and comfortable interior compared to its predecessors. In a word, a high level of performance is felt in the car. At the same time, the original version of the hatchback, called the Neo, was also produced for the domestic market - this car is easily recognizable by the characteristic curved line of the side windows and its striking design, which distinguishes itself from the Mazda Lantis sports coupe. The body design of Familia Neo is of great height, with the help of which designers tried to increase the interior space of the cabin to meet the requirements of a pro-American consumer. However, despite such an exterior decision, which was somewhat ahead of its time, Neo was categorically rejected by the main target audience - lovers of compact cars that preferred the usual Familia sedan and hatchback. Complete sets of this generation of the sedan were offered starting with the basic version of the ES, an interesting very low price compared to competitors. And with LS equipment and above, air conditioning, a power steering and a wide list of other equipment (much like an option) were already offered: alloy wheels, electric sunroof, rear spoiler, fog lights, power windows and central locking, folding mirrors, additional light shades, bottle holders, pockets doors and additional storage areas for small items, parking sensors, remote control key, climate control. The audio system in its simplest form is a radio or cassette player, and in more expensive versions an optional two-single AM ​​/ FM / CD player or even a TV tuner with an LCD screen and a remote control. In the top-end version of Interplay X, the car was equipped with the most powerful motor, 195 / 55R15 wheels, elements of a sports body kit. In 1996, facelift was carried out with minor changes in the exterior and interior. Mazda Familia is associated with such important concepts as economy and environmental friendliness. The model was equipped with various types of engines, but at first only 1.5 and 1.8 liter engines in various modifications with power from 97 to 135 hp were offered from gasoline. Only later, in 1996, in the wake of updating the model, the 1.3-liter unit with 85 hp returned to the range of engines. (Type C and Type S modifications) and a 1.6-liter engine with a capacity of 115 liters was added. with. The sedan was also offered with a 1.7-liter diesel engine rated at 88 hp.

 The car retains the same type of independent suspension design on suspension struts with coil springs. Ventilated front disc brakes, rear drum brakes, but for versions with a 1.8-liter engine - and rear disc brakes. An all-wheel drive version of this model was also produced, though only a sedan and only in versions with a 1.6-liter engine or 1.7 diesel. The wheelbase of the car pretty well increased - from 2450 mm to 2605 mm, which contributed to a better organization of the interior space.

 Until 1996, the basic list of sedan safety equipment was almost identical to that offered by the previous generation, but front seat belts with pretensioners were installed in expensive trim levels, and front airbags and an anti-lock brake system were offered as an option. After updating the model, part of this list was included in the standard equipment of all versions: driver’s pillow, front belts with pretensioners. In general, the level of car safety has increased - the car has successfully passed crash tests according to various standards. The innovative design of the Neo hatchback, among other things, contributed to better visibility, and more advanced aerodynamics contributed to the cleanliness of the windows and side mirrors. The eighth generation in terms of the variety of modifications looks a little more modest than the previous one, largely due to objective difficulties affecting all Japanese automakers in the 90s. However, despite this, it should be noted a progressive approach and attention to the interior space, thanks to which Familia stands just above its "classmates", especially in terms of the amount of space in the back. Given the affordable price, simple and fairly reliable chassis, a good set of positive qualities was obtained, which at one time contributed to the popularity of the model among the used right-hand drive cars imported into Russia in the zero years.
In 1994, the Mazda station wagon Mazda Familia Wagon appeared on the Japanese market, manufactured with the Y10 index and representing a copy of the Nissan Sunny California station wagon, in the same body type as the Nissan AD Wagon (Y10). It was produced on the basis of an OEM agreement between the companies. This car has nothing to do with the Mazda Familia family cars produced in parallel and was offered only for the domestic market (right-hand drive). At the same time, the model successfully fit into the Familia line and actually became the successor to the five-door version of the 6th generation Familia station wagon (type BF), which existed in the Mazda model range from 1989 to 1994. Only two types of engines were installed on the Familia Wagon: gasoline with a volume of 1.5 liters (94 hp) and diesel - 2.0 liters (76 hp). In this version, the Mazda Familia station wagon was discontinued in May 1996 due to the transition to OEM production of a copy of the new Nissan Wingroad model.  If we talk about equipping the station wagon Mazda Familia 1994-1996, then it is quite good, because the basis is not the most primitive basic equipment, but a quite advanced version, called XE, which can offer a power steering, radio, tilt-adjustable steering column, air conditioning, power windows and a central lock, and the options offered fog lights and a rear wiper. However, with a diesel engine, an affordable, more utilitarian version of XE extra was offered, which was devoid of power accessories, and foglights and a rear wiper were not offered even for a surcharge. The latter was standardly offered in the XG configuration (only a gasoline engine and four-wheel drive), along with additional options like tinted windows and a radio tape recorder. In the summer of 1995, the equipment was improved due to the appearance in the list of additional equipment of the sunroof, RV-package ("for walks and excursions") and roof rails. A car was produced with front-wheel drive and four-wheel drive. The latter was available only on versions with a gasoline engine. As already mentioned, two types of engines were installed on the Mazda Familia station wagon: gasoline GA15 with a volume of 1.5 liters and a maximum power of 94 hp (126 Nm) and diesel CD20 - 2.0 l with a capacity of 76 hp (132 Nm). Also for the station wagon, the manufacturer provided two types of gearboxes: a four-speed automatic and five-speed mechanics. Thus, the total number of variations in the engine and transmission reached six. In this generation, engineers have done everything possible to reduce fuel consumption. Therefore, gasoline modifications consumed 5.6 - 8.6 liters of fuel in the combined cycle, and the fuel consumption of diesel cars was even less: 3.3 - 4.2 liters. The volume of the fuel tank is 50 liters.

 In front, the station wagon has an independent suspension with MacPherson strut, two options at the rear: either a semi-independent beam in front-wheel drive cars, or a dependent suspension (bridge) in all-wheel drive. In some front-wheel drive versions, the car could be equipped with a limited slip differential for a fee. Ahead of the Mazda Familia station wagon installed disc brakes, and rear - drum brakes. All steering options include power steering. Dimensions wagon has the following: 4175 x 1665 x 1480 mm (L x W x H). Interior dimensions - 1700 x 1390 x 1205 mm. Wheelbase - 2400 mm. The turning radius is 4.5-4.9 m. Ground clearance - 14-15 cm. Car loading capacity is 400 kg. Trunk volume - at the wagon level of the middle class, if not more.

 From security systems, the standard equipment of the Mazda Familia Y10 1994-1996 includes three-point belts (except for the central back seat), door stiffeners, driver airbag (standard since 1995); Anti-lock braking system is available as an option.  For the wagon Mazda Familia 1994-1996, the same advantages and disadvantages are characteristic as for the Nissan donor model. Mazda Familia Wagon is designed to fit five and has a roomy trunk for transporting goods. The car has simple and reliable engines, as well as gearboxes. Cons - poor body corrosion protection and stiffer suspension.
